Georgina received a altered peppermint tin from her all time heroine Heidi, so of course I just had to get one to play with myself (just call me copycat)

I sandpapered the paint off and then gessoed it, the rest is just a mixture of paints, bits heated with the heatgun so that they bubbled... the inside is filled with Jewels which befits the 'King Tut & treasure' theme.
The good old faithful Cropodile came into it's own to cut a hole in the side, which is where I hung various 'charms'
